Understanding the Essentials
The video begins by setting the stage, emphasizing the importance of a clean and organized Blender file before exporting. As ProjProd points out, a little preparation in Blender goes a long way in preventing headaches later on in Unreal Engine. This includes paying close attention to the Armature and its root, ensuring everything is properly aligned and scaled.
One of the most crucial aspects highlighted is the Armature setup. ProjProd stresses the importance of having a clear understanding of your rig’s hierarchy and ensuring that the root bone is correctly positioned. This foundational step helps Unreal Engine interpret the rig’s structure accurately, preventing unexpected deformations or control issues.
Modifiers, Transforms, and Scale: The Holy Trinity
Modifiers can be a blessing and a curse when it comes to exporting. ProjProd advises applying necessary modifiers like Subdivision Surface before exporting, as this ensures the mesh’s final form is what gets transferred to Unreal Engine. However, it’s equally important to be mindful of which modifiers to keep active, especially those driving animation or deformation.
Applying transforms is another critical step. Freezing the scale, rotation, and location of your objects ensures that Unreal Engine interprets the intended size and orientation correctly. As ProjProd demonstrates, failing to apply transforms can lead to bizarre scaling issues that can be difficult to fix within Unreal Engine.
Rig scale is often a major culprit behind import problems. ProjProd dedicates a significant portion of the video to this topic, offering practical advice on how to check and adjust the scale of your rig before exporting. Getting the scale right from the outset minimizes the need for tedious adjustments within Unreal Engine.
Naming Conventions and Export Settings
Consistent and descriptive naming conventions are not just good practice; they’re essential for a smooth workflow between Blender and Unreal Engine. ProjProd emphasizes the importance of clear naming for bones, meshes, and materials, making it easier to identify and manipulate assets within Unreal Engine.
The FBX export settings can make or break the import process. ProjProd provides a detailed walkthrough of the optimal settings for exporting from Blender to Unreal Engine, including specific options for Armatures, meshes, and animations. These settings are tailored to ensure compatibility and prevent common import errors.
Importing and Refining in Unreal Engine
Once the FBX file is exported, the video transitions to Unreal Engine, demonstrating the import process and highlighting key settings to consider. ProjProd also touches on the topic of Morph Targets, explaining how to import and utilize them for facial expressions or other detailed deformations.
